Transaction 3a75935fb432ca62e9705c5c3918cbbe1cd425b27f492572914a7162b39e2a91

1 Input
2 Outputs
  • 3a75935fb432ca62e9705c5c3918cbbe1cd425b27f492572914a7162b39e2a91:0
  • value  31000000
    address  1Fstr23XbnJeXWvfua6mufTPrk4pWYCDW6
  • 3a75935fb432ca62e9705c5c3918cbbe1cd425b27f492572914a7162b39e2a91:1
  • value  12769610
    address  16mUW48jA4RtbLZg8pSihzhooCBLx957c